[feat] TransformControl has a label showing it’s transform vector #434

Currently, I am working on a project where I use TransformControl extensively to easily determine an object’s position. I can use console logs or TresLeches to show the current position, rotation, or scale of the object. Wouldn’t it be nice to have an optional reactive label displayed with the current mode value? When transform is the mode, it shows the Vector3 for the object’s position.

Features:

  • A prop to enable a label showing the Vector3 for current mode (scale, position, rotation) or all at once.
  • When you shift + click the label, it copies the vector value to your clipboard.
  • Not sure yet where it should show, either at the bottom left corner or as an HTML component at the object’s center.

I have already made a small demo and can continue upon receiving the green light. ✅
